Roadies will pick up you and your crew at your residence, hotel, airbnb, or a predetermined location. We will have a cooler with ice and water and plenty of room for whatever else you want to bring. We will then drive you to your first stop.
Brewery or establishment of your choice. Other recommendations: Fly Trap Brewing, HiWire Brewing, Ponysaurus, Oden Brewing.
Spend 30-45 minutes at your first stop tasting local beers.
2nd brewery or establishment of your choice. Other suggestions: Fly Trap Brewing, Flying Machine Brewing, Wilmington Brewing, or Drumtrout Brewing. Spend 30-60 minutes at your 2nd stop. This would be a good stop to eat and most breweries have food trucks during the day.
3rd stop: Brewery or establishment of your choice. Spend 45-60 minutes at your 3rd stop. After, we will drop you back off at your home, hotel, airbnb, or final location of your choice. Other suggestions: Mad Mole brewing, Wrightsville Beach Brewing, End of Days Distillery

Wilmington, North Carolina, is a charming coastal city known for its rich history, beautiful beaches, and vibrant arts scene. Nestled along the Cape Fear River, it offers a unique blend of Southern hospitality, historic architecture, and outdoor adventures.
